Transaction 04f3753f761d5432d301c49fdfdf657d72b096d8e75b5c8c981e72260452063c

3 Input
2 Outputs
  • 04f3753f761d5432d301c49fdfdf657d72b096d8e75b5c8c981e72260452063c:0
  • value  25410200
    address  13BFmzN5DpXR8Xr5bRWF5yAkNM4mADdEaE
  • 04f3753f761d5432d301c49fdfdf657d72b096d8e75b5c8c981e72260452063c:1
  • value  136805565
    address  1L8bhWaYASwpr46T3sMbftobLwwtmpU2Mn